Do you want to know more about setting up your KLOE folders to hold your evidence on your desktop PC/laptop? To hold all your evidence in relation to collecting emails, Word docs, Excel docs, scanned in forms and lots more - to match against the new Single Assessment Framework Quality Statements?

We will show you how to have a folder for each: SAFE / EFFECTIVE / CARING / RESONSIVE / WELL LED.

As an example within the SAFE folder you will have sub folders for areas like:

• Compliments

• Policies

• Audit of your medicines management

• Infection control evidence

• Staff training on safeguarding

• Safe recruitment processes

• Risk assessment evidence

• Evidence of safe staff levels

• Evidence of safe handovers between staff shifts

• Notifications folder evidencing any safeguarding issues

• Observations of carers/support workers giving medication to clients

You will get to see what items can be collected in all the KLOE folders to match against the Quality Statements, in readiness for your inspection.

You will be provided with a prompt spreadsheet to look at what evidence you already have, so that a gap analysis can highlight what areas you are missing and what you need to concentrate on.

We will also look at the 6 Evidence Categories and how we use our evidence collected to match against these six categories:

• People's experience of health and care services

• Feedback from staff and leaders

• Feedback from partners

• Observation

• Processes

• Outcomes
